Rule Abstractor is a tool by Peter Baron that provides concise rules derived from test Q&As, aimed at helping users to understand and summarize complex information in a simplified manner, which can be useful for studying and memorizing key concepts. The tool uses advanced AI models like DALL-E and browser integration to derive these rules efficiently and effectively.
